ORDER by Judge Haywood S. Gilliam, Jr. Granting 26 Joint Motion to Allow Plaintiff to File a First Amended Complaint. Amended Pleadings due by 10/4/2017. (ndrS, COURT STAFF) (Filed on 9/14/2017)
